    Abstract: A vehicle includes an interior cabin, a primary structure within the interior cabin, a plurality of securing mounts having first ends directly coupled to the primary structure, and second ends, and an overhead support platform system directly coupled to the second ends of the plurality of securing mounts. The overhead support platform system includes at least one adapter rail having a plurality of commodity mounts. At least one commodity is directly coupled to the overhead support platform system. The commodity is adaptively secured to one or more of the plurality of commodity mounts.

    Abstract: Systems and methods are provided for securing aircraft sidewall. One embodiment comprises a hanger for supporting sections of sidewall for an aircraft. The hanger includes an elongated vertical member that attaches to a frame of the aircraft, and sets of keyholes that are each arranged in a vertical pattern along the member and that are each configured to support a corresponding section of sidewall of the aircraft. Each keyhole includes a receptacle dimensioned to receive a fitting from a section of sidewall, and a slot dimensioned to slidably accept the fitting via the receptacle to secure the fitting in place. The slot size of keyholes in each set varies from one end of the vertical pattern to another end of the vertical pattern.

    Abstract: There is provided an air grille panel assembly for a vehicle. The assembly includes an air grille panel having air grille openings, a top end, and a bottom end. The top end is configured for coupling to a sidewall panel in a cabin of the vehicle. The bottom end is configured for coupling to a raceway assembly on a floor in the cabin. The assembly further includes a frame member disposed around a perimeter of each of the air grille openings, to define each of the air grille openings, an air grille coupled to the frame member and covering each of the air grille openings, and a cover member releasably attached to the air grille. The assembly is configured for coupling to the sidewall panel, via a float attachment, that allows for a vertical adjustment, to accommodate different installed positions of the assembly in the cabin of the vehicle.

    Abstract: Disclosed herein is an example ceiling header system for an aircraft cabin that includes a ceiling between a first storage bin and a second storage bin. The ceiling header system includes a ceiling header that includes a top surface that conforms to the ceiling and a bottom surface that is opposite the top surface. The ceiling header system also includes a curtain track. The top surface is configured to be held against the ceiling via the curtain track being placed against the bottom surface, the curtain track being (i) attachable at a first end of the curtain track to a first rail of the first storage bin and (ii) attachable at a second end of the curtain track to a second rail of the second storage bin.
